Type of method:
differential scanning calorimetry
Key result
Boiling pt.:
> 280 °C
Atm. press.:
1 009.9 hPa
Decomposition:
yes

The melting of the test substance at 264°C is immediately followed by the beginning of decomposition (exothermic effect) at 280°C.

At 1009.9 hPa no boiling point is observed.

Conclusions:
At 1009.9 hPa no boiling point of the test item is observed. Decomposition begins at approximately 280°C.
